Activities

We offer an extensive programme of pre-planned group activities.  The following list is illustrative of the activities held during a typical month:

  • Marking of special events – Burns Night, Valentines Day, Wimbledon, Easter, VE Day, Halloween etc
  • Weekly Manicure & Pamper Mornings
  • PAT Dog Visits (3-4 times a month)
  • Visits from Monarch Farm (Spring & Summer)
  • Monthly visits from local Hartbeeps Children’s Group delivering themed multi-sensory mornings with multi-generational interaction
  • Quizzes
  • Film Mornings
  • Knit and Natter sessions
  • Monthly visit by the local Cannon
  • External entertainers including The Piano Man, Liz The Saxophonist, Singalong with the Rat Pack, Sled Dogs as Therapy UK and more
  • Coffee & Cake Mornings and Cheese & Port Mornings
  • Craft Making
  • Bingo Mornings
  • Table-Top activity afternoons
  • Summer Gardening Club
  • Residents Meetings (once a month)
  • 24/7 Access to our ‘Magic Table’ situated in the main dining room area. This projector encourages sensory stimulation, relaxation and reminiscence to residents individually or in group sessions.

Residents have the choice of participating in some or all of these. There are also individual one-to-one activities to cater for the specific interests of residents.

Residents are able to enjoy a sensory courtyard garden that is accessible from the lounge. There is also a separate dedicated residents’ garden, with raised beds, for those interested in gardening. The home has an active gardening club.

Finally, there is a meeting with each resident every month to solicit feedback on specific topics.
